研究生: |
陳建文 Jian-Wen Chen |
---|---|
論文名稱: |
H.264中全文自適應二進制算術編碼的硬體設計 A Hardware Context-Based Adaptive Binary Arithmetic Decoder for H.264 Advanced Video Coding |
指導教授: |
林永隆
Youn-Long Lin |
口試委員: | |
學位類別: |
碩士 Master |
系所名稱: |
電機資訊學院 - 資訊工程學系 Computer Science |
論文出版年: | 2005 |
畢業學年度: | 93 |
語文別: | 英文 |
論文頁數: | 34 |
中文關鍵詞: | 全文自適應二進制算術編碼 |
外文關鍵詞: | CABAC |
相關次數: | 點閱:3 下載:0 |
分享至: |
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報 |
我們在此論文中提出在H.264/AVC中全文自適應二進制算術編碼的硬體架構設計,我們還提出了一個有效率的記憶體編排架構,方便我們的設計和其他部分如移動補償(motion compensation),反離散餘弦函數轉換(IDCT)做整合,對於讀取鄰近的資料方面,我們提出了一個管線架構來減少時脈數,我們所發展高效能的有限狀態機(finite state machine),使我的設計只需用二到三個時脈數就能解出一個位元,我們的設計也在(FPGA)上做過驗證,從實驗的結果可以發現,我們的設計可及時解壓縮 1280 x 720 的影像規格
We propose a hardware accelerator for Context-based Adaptive Binary Arithmetic decoding (CABAC) in H.264/AVC. We also propose an efficient memory system for easy integration with other components such as motion compensation and IDCT. For getting neighboring data, we propose a pipelined architecture to reduce clock cycles. We develop an efficient finite state machine so that our design can generate one bit every 2 to 3 clock cycles. Our design is verified in FPGA prototyping by using an ARM integrator. Experimental result shows that our design is capable of decoding main profile 720P (1280 x 720) video stream at 30 fps.
[1] T. Wiegand, G. J. Sullivan, G. Bjontegaard, and A.Luthra, “Overview of the H.264/AVC video coding standard”, IEEE Transactions on Circuits and Systems for Video Technology, pp. 560-576, July 2003.
[2] Marpe, D.; Schwarz, H.; Wiegand, T. “Context-based adaptive binary arithmetic coding in the H.264/AVC video compression standard”, IEEE Transactions on Circuits and Systems for Video Technology, pp: 620-636 July 2003.
[3] Draft ITU-T Recommendation and Final Draft International Standard of Joint Video Specification (ITU-T Rec. H.264|ISO/IEC 14496-10 AVC)
[4] JVT H.264/AVC Reference Software JM 7.3
[5] Osorio, R.R.; Bruguera, J.D “Arithmetic coding architecture for H.264/AVC CABAC compression system” ,Euromicro Symposium on Digital System Design, Page(s):62 – 69, 31 Aug.-3 Sept. 2004
[6] Mrak, M.; Marpe, D.; Wiegand, T. “A context modeling algorithm and its application in video compression”, IEEE 2003 International Conference on Image Processing Page(s):III - 845-8 ,Sept 2003
[7] Ha, V.H.S.; Woo-Sung Shim; Jung-Woo Kim “Real-time MPEG-4 AVC/H.264 CABAC entropy coder”, IEEE 2005 International Conference on Consumer Electronics Page(s):255 - 256